biopharma equipment plays a crucial role in the production and development of life-saving pharmaceutical products. These machines are specially designed to handle the complex processes involved in biopharmaceutical manufacturing, ensuring the safety, quality, and efficacy of the final product. From research and development to production and packaging, biopharma equipment is essential at every step of the pharmaceutical manufacturing process.
One of the key reasons biopharma equipment is so important in the pharmaceutical industry is its ability to automate and streamline the production process. In the highly regulated and competitive world of pharmaceutical manufacturing, efficiency is key to maintaining a competitive edge. biopharma equipment allows pharmaceutical companies to produce large quantities of drugs quickly and accurately, reducing human error and ensuring consistent quality control. This automation also helps to reduce the risk of contamination and ensures that products meet strict regulatory standards.
biopharma equipment also plays a critical role in ensuring the safety of pharmaceutical products. The machines used in biopharmaceutical manufacturing are designed to meet stringent requirements for cleanliness, sterility, and accuracy. This is particularly important in the production of biologics, which are derived from living organisms and can be more sensitive to contamination than traditional chemical drugs. By using specialized equipment, pharmaceutical companies can ensure that their products are free from impurities and meet the highest standards of quality and safety.
